This week’s #SaturdayShoutout goes to the incredible Bethany Barnes who completed her second 7.5 mile fundraising walk around Ennerdale Water this July, joined by around 70 friends and family members 🥾🧡 In December 2019, aged 22, Bethany was diagnosed with osteosarcoma. Just one month later, she went on to complete her first fundraising walk, raising an amazing £4,700 and vital awareness along the way. In the months that followed, Bethany had her hip, femur and knee replaced and received multiple rounds of chemotherapy. After completing her treatment, Bethany’s scans remained clear for three years. Devastatingly, in October 2023, Bethany was diagnosed with a recurrence of osteosarcoma in her hip and had no option but to have her leg and part of her pelvis removed. When reflecting on her second Ennerdale Water walk, Bethany shared: “I'd love to hopefully finish off my cancer journey this summer by doing the same walk I started with to raise more awareness and money for this amazing charity.” We’d like to say a HUGE thank you to Bethany and all her supporters for raising an incredible £7,600 this summer and a phenomenal total of £12,300 across both walks. Jodi's son, Brandon, was diagnosed with osteosarcoma in his spine when he was 16 years old. Following surgery to remove the initial tumour, Brandon's cancer returned, and the new tumour doubled in size within just two weeks. Despite further treatment, Brandon tragically passed away on 16th August 2021. There are over 7,000 people living with and beyond bone sarcoma (primary bone cancer) in the UK. This includes Poonam, who was just nine years old when she was diagnosed with osteosarcoma at the start of the millenium.
